Harry Curtis was Gillingham manager between 1923 and 1926 before leaving to take over at Brentford where he remained for the next 23 years. I am currently looking into the possibility of producing and publishing a book to cover his life. I have discovered a comprehensive diary that he wrote, serialised in a newspaper, in 1947 which looked back over his lengthy period of time as Brentford secretary/manger.
However, I have virtually no knowledge of his earlier life, especially the time he spent at Gillingham, which followed a spell as a Football League referee.
